Topics Covered
- Introduction to Edge Computing: Understand the fundamentals and principles of edge computing.
- Robot Perception Systems: Explore the basics of robot perception and its components.
- Sensor Technologies for Robotics: Learn about various sensors used in robot perception systems.
- Data Processing at the Edge: Study techniques for efficient data processing in edge computing environments.
- Real-Time Robot Perception: Delve into methods for achieving real-time perception in robotics.
- Case Studies in Edge Computing for Robotics: Analyze real-world applications of edge computing in robot perception systems.
